I was struck when I corrected data for inflation and population growth. In no way is Trump policy a correction of some overreach. The Biden years were middling for science funding in the 21st century. This is retrenchment to a time before most Americans were born. grant-witness.us/posts/2026-0... 🧪
NSF's grantmaking is miserly when compared to recent years, but when compared it to the historical record, we see it's a radical break from the long-term consensus of investing in scientific innovation. grant-witness.us/posts/2026-0... #NSF 🧪
The NSF is on Track for its Worst Year in Generations – Grant Witness
Throttling of science funding is utterly unprecedented and radical when compared to the past 50 years.
